The heart of the Scrum method lies in its three core roles: the Product Owner, who defines the product vision and prioritizes features; the Development Team, responsible for coding and testing the software; and the Scrum Master, who facilitates the process and resolves impediments. This clear division of responsibilities ensures effective collaboration and accountability within the project team.

Through regular Sprint cycles, Scrum promotes incremental progress and continuous feedback. Each sprint typically lasts one weeks, culminating in a updated product increment. Daily standups serve as crucial communication touchpoints, allowing a team to synchronize their efforts and identify any issues blocking progress. Sprint reviews offer valuable opportunities for stakeholders to inspect the completed increment and provide feedback, ensuring it aligns with evolving needs.

Firstly, it's crucial to understand the three primary Scrum artifacts: the product read more backlog, the sprint backlog, and the increment. The product backlog is a living document that outlines all the desired features and improvements of the software. The sprint backlog, on the other hand, encapsulates the tasks that a team commits to completing within a sprint, which is typically a three-week iteration. The increment represents the functional software produced at the end of each sprint.

Moreover, understanding the Scrum roles is crucial. The product owner is the voice for the stakeholders, responsible for communicating the product vision and prioritizing the features in the product backlog.

The scrum master acts as a facilitator, coach, and guardian of the Scrum process, ensuring that the Scrum team adheres to its principles and practices. Finally, the development team is responsible for creating the software increment, working collaboratively within sprints.
